Richa D3O Diablo Level 2 Protectors - Shoulder Comes as a pair Lightest, most breathable D3O limb protector ever made with 38.5% open surface area Ultraslim design at only 9.5mm thick Made using soft, free-flowing IM material for unparalleled comfort and flexibility Pre-curved for a precision fit Easy integration: shape matches LP range integrated garments Engineered to use less material, reducing environmental footprint Trusted, consistent performance across a wide range of temperatures CE Level 2 certified (EN 1621-1) Crafted for devilish speed on two wheels. D3O's lightest, most breathable limb protector ever. D3O Diablo™ is engineered for subconscious advantage whilst riding. More comfortable than any other limb armour that surpasses CE Level 2 certification.

Richa is a hugely popular brand for all kinds of bike clothing, but its roots lie in glove manufacture. Charles Rigaux started making leather gloves in 1952, four years later his son Julien founded a business in his name and in 1977 Julien's son Luc led their entry into the world of motorcycling. The company offers a vast range of gloves to suit all riders, from entry-level summer and winter gloves all the way up to premium Gore-Tex offerings and high-tech heated gloves. With a value-for-money approach, Richa is one of the most popular brands with Sportsbikeshop customers.
